How to Be Happy Every Day: 10 Simple Tips to Light Up Your Life
Let’s face it—life isn’t always easy. Some days feel like everything is going wrong, and happiness seems out of reach. But here’s the truth: happiness doesn’t depend on perfect circumstances. It’s something we can create, little by little, with our mindset and daily actions.
If you’re looking for ways to feel genuinely happy every day without grand plans or life changing events. Here are 10 heartfelt tips that can help to bring more light and joy into the life.
1. Lessen Your Needs and Increase Your Responsibilities
We often associate happiness with more and more money, achievements, or possessions. However, what if true happiness comes from needing less? When we let go of excessive desires and embrace simplicity, we free ourselves from the endless cycle of wanting and dissatisfaction.
At the same time, meaningful responsibilities can bring profound joy. Whether it is supporting loved ones, helping out someone in need, or mentoring others, dedicating your time and energy to something greater than yourself creates a sense of purpose and fulfillment that deeply nourishes your soul.
Why it works: Real happiness isn't about having everything you want, but about appreciating what you already have and finding purpose in what you give to the world.
2. Look at People with Greater Problems Than You
When you’re feeling overwhelmed, it’s easy to get stuck in your own struggles. But stepping back and looking at others who are dealing with bigger challenges can shift your perspective.
This is definitely not comparing pain or invalidating your feelings. It's realizing that even in the hard times, there's just so much to be grateful for - maybe it's health, a warm home, or perhaps somebody to talk to.
Why it works: Gratitude transforms how you view your life. Focusing on what you have, not on what you lack, brings peace and clarity.
3. Don’t Be Unhappy About Being Unhappy
This one sounds kind of kooky, but hear me out. We can, at times, make things worse by beating ourselves up about feeling sad, frustrated, or anxious. "Why am I not happier?" we ask, piling guilt on top of everything else.
The thing is, it's perfectly fine to feel miserable sometimes. Life isn't supposed to be all sunflowers and daisies all the time. Those heavy emotions are a part of being human, so let them roll through you, reminding yourself they're just temporary.
Why it works: When you quit resisting your feelings, they just pass easier. When you accept the lows, then space is made for the highs.
4. Drop Unpleasant Memories and Live in the Present
We all carry around painful memories of when we failed, were hurt, or lost something precious. Though we must learn from the past, holding on to painful memories only keeps us stuck.
Let go of what you can't change. Instead, be in the present moment. That is where life lives. Whether it is the taste of your coffee, the sound of laughter, or the warmth of the sun on your face, there is so much beauty in the now.
Why it works: Being in the present makes one forget their yesterday and fear not tomorrow.
5. Share Your Happiness with Others
Have you ever noticed the joy you feel when you get someone else to smile? Sharing your happiness—no matter how small it is it always multiplies.
It can be as simple as sending a thoughtful text, lending a hand, or just being there for someone. And when you give love, kindness, or time, it creates a ripple effect that comes back to you in ways you never think of.
Why it works: Happiness is one that grows the more you share it. The more love and positivity is given to others, the more it reflects back, filling the heart with even greater happiness.
6. Know That Everything Is Temporary
Both the good times and the bad times share one thing: they are temporary. This simple truth is at once humbling and empowering.
When things are going bad, remind yourself this too shall pass. When life is good, take your time to enjoy every moment, as it's precious and fleeting. Acceptance of the impermanence of life makes you appreciate life more deeply.
Why it works: Knowing everything is temporary keeps you grounded during struggles and grateful during joys.
7. Have Faith—It Brings Peace
Faith does not necessarily mean faith in religion; it could be faith in oneself, faith in life, or just a faith that things will get better. Faith gives you hope when it's tough and reminds that you are not alone.
Sometimes, simply telling yourself, "I will figure this out" or "Better days are ahead" can lift a huge weight off your shoulders.
Why it works: Faith replaces fear. It's quiet strength that keeps you moving forward, even though the road ahead feels uncertain.
8. Protect Your Mind at All Costs
Your mind is your most valuable asset. It’s where your thoughts, emotions, and decisions begin. Protect it fiercely. Avoid negativity, whether it’s toxic people, constant bad news, or self-criticism.
Instead, feed your mind with uplifting content—books, music, conversations, and even silence. Make time to rest, meditate, or simply breathe.
Why it works: A healthy mind is the foundation of happiness that is really true. When your thoughts are clear and positive, life feels lighter.
9. Decide Not to Let Anything Steal Your Happiness
Happiness is a choice—one with great power. Life will throw some challenges at you, but you are in control of how you choose to respond. It does not mean that one lets situations get the best of them, but takes charge of the mindset instead.
This is not denial; it's facing issues head-on with resilience and not letting them rob you of happiness.
Why it works? Consider happiness as a treasure. Protect it carefully and do not let storms snatch this away.
10. Dedicate Your Life to a Larger Goal
When happiness is linked with short-term pleasures, it always feels so transient. When you give your life up to something bigger than that—a cause, a purpose, or a mission—that is where you find real fulfillment in life.
Think about what truly matters to you. Perhaps it is helping others, building a legacy, or simply making the world a kinder place. When your actions align with your values, every day feels meaningful.
Why it works: Purpose provides life with depth. It turns mundane days into amazing journeys.
Conclusion
Happiness is not about the life being perfect, it's all about finding beauty in flaws. It's making those small choices, every single day, to nurture the heart and soul. Start with one tip that resonates with you. Practice it, feel it, and let it become part of the life. Gradually, these little changes will make a big difference.
Happiness is already within you. So, let it shine.
